Understanding the Costs: Transportation and Accommodation Options

Understanding ‍the Costs: Transportation and Accommodation Options

When planning your dream trip to the Bahamas, understanding the cost‍ of ‍getting there and where to ⁣stay is crucial for staying within budget.Transportation options vary from‍ the affordable to the‍ extravagant, allowing you to⁤ tailor your experience⁤ based on your spending ability.

Transportation Options

  • Flights: Major ⁣airlines service multiple airports in ‍the Bahamas, with competitive pricing varying based ⁣on the⁣ season.​ It’s advisable‌ to book well in⁤ advance and compare rates across different travel websites.
  • Ferries: For inter-island travel,ferries offer a scenic and budget-friendly option. Routes connect ⁣popular islands at reasonable ‍prices, usually ranging from​ $30 to ‌$100 per trip,‌ depending on the distance.
  • Car Rentals: Renting a car is​ a convenient ‍way to explore at your own pace.​ Expect to pay roughly $50 ⁣to⁢ $150 per day depending on the vehicle type and rental agency.
  • Taxi & ‌rideshare: Taxis are ⁣widely available,⁤ but costs⁤ can add up quickly; fares often start at $5, with‍ additional charges‍ based on distance. Rideshare services operate in ​some areas​ as well.

Accommodation Options

Once you arrive, choosing the right ‍place⁢ to ‍stay‍ can shape your overall⁢ experience. The Bahamas offers a variety of accommodations from budget to luxury, appealing to all travelers.

Type of Accommodation Price ​Range ‍per Night
Hostels $30 – $70
Mid-Range⁣ Hotels $100 – ​$250
Luxury Resorts $300 and up
Vacation Rentals $80 – ‍$300

Dining‍ on ⁤a​ Budget: Local Cuisine and Affordable ⁤Restaurants

Dining on a Budget: Local Cuisine and Affordable Restaurants

when exploring the culinary landscape of the ​Bahamas, your ​taste buds‌ are in for a treat without straining your wallet. Local‌ cuisine is both rich in flavor⁣ and steeped in tradition, offering delightful dishes​ that are not only affordable but⁢ also give ⁢you a genuine taste of Bahamian culture.

Here are ‌a few must-try dishes:

  • Conch Fritters: A‍ staple of the Bahamas, these deep-fried bites are loved ⁤by ‌locals and tourists alike.
  • bahamian Rock ​Lobsters: Enjoy ​this local ⁢delicacy grilled ‌or​ in a stew, available at various‌ beachside shacks.
  • Souse: A traditional soup made with meat, lime, ‌and ​spices, perfect⁢ for a light meal.
  • Johnny Cakes: these tasty cornmeal‌ treats are an accompanying dish you can’t miss!

For affordable dining⁤ options that showcase local⁣ flavors, consider ‌visiting:

Restaurant Name Location Specialty Price Range
Fish Fry (Arawak Cay) Nassau Conch ‌Fritters $5 – $15
bahamian Cookin’ Nassau Traditional‍ Souse $10 – $20
Wreckers’ Restaurant Harbour ⁤Island Rock‍ Lobsters $15 -⁣ $30
Goldie’s Exuma Johnny Cakes $3 – ⁤$10

These eateries not only offer some of the best local dishes but are also known for their friendly atmospheres and reasonable⁤ prices. Activities⁤ for Every‍ Wallet: Free and Low-Cost attractions

Activities for Every Wallet: Free and Low-Cost ⁣Attractions

Exploring ‍the Bahamas ⁣doesn’t have ⁣to break ‌the bank.With numerous free and​ low-cost attractions, you can soak in the stunning beauty and rich culture of⁢ this Caribbean paradise without the hefty price tag. Whether you’re an adventure seeker or someone looking to relax, there are⁢ plenty⁢ of budget-friendly ‌options that promise unforgettable experiences.

  • Beaches: the Bahamas is famous for its pristine coastline.Enjoy a day‍ at public beaches like Cable​ Beach⁤ in​ Nassau or Pink Sands Beach ​in Harbour Island. These sun-soaked spots offer crystal-clear waters without any entry‌ fees.
  • National Parks: Explore the natural beauty of the Bahamas ‍through ⁤its ⁣national‍ parks. Places like Exuma Cays Land and Sea Park allow you to hike and take in the sights ​for a nominal fee, offering stunning views and⁣ wildlife​ encounters.
  • Local Festivals: Immerse yourself in Bahamian culture by attending local festivals​ and markets. Events like Junkanoo provide free entertainment with vibrant parades filled with⁤ music ‌and dance.
  • Self-Guided Tours: Check out downtown Nassau, ⁣where you can stroll along‌ Bay⁣ street to explore colorful​ buildings, local shops, and iconic landmarks​ like the Queen’s Staircase and Fort Fincastle—all at no cost.
Attraction Cost Description
Queen’s Staircase Free A historic stairway with 66 steps carved out of solid limestone.
Fort Fincastle Low Cost offers panoramic views of Nassau for a small entry fee.
Exuma Cays‍ Land and Sea Park Small Fee A protected area ideal for snorkeling and hiking.
Cable Beach Free Stunning beach known for its soft sand and clear waters.

Seasonal Considerations: When ⁢to Visit for​ the Best Deals

When planning​ your budget-friendly adventure to the Bahamas, timing can make all ‌the difference.‌ The peak tourist season typically‍ runs from‌ mid-December to mid-April,coinciding with pleasant weather‌ and holiday travel. However, this ​is also when prices for accommodations,⁣ flights, and tours can soar. If you’re looking to stretch your dollars further,consider visiting during the shoulder seasons.

  • Late April to Early June: This ‍period sees a slight dip⁣ in tourist numbers as families return‍ home after spring break. Many resorts and airlines offer ⁤attractive⁣ deals to fill ⁢their vacancies.
  • september to Early ​November: The months leading ⁢up to the hurricane season often offer the deepest ‌discounts. While‍ there is a chance of inclement weather, many travelers find this a worthwhile ‍risk for the dramatic savings.
  • Weekdays vs. Weekends: ⁤ Traveling ‍midweek rather ‌than on the⁢ weekend can often yield better rates for flights​ and accommodations.

What are some budget-friendly tips for visiting the Bahamas?

Visiting the Bahamas on a budget is⁤ entirely achievable with some⁤ planning and creativity. Accommodation can frequently enough take a notable portion of your ⁤travel budget, but you can save by exploring less touristy areas. Look for guesthouses, budget hotels, or even Airbnb options, notably on ⁣islands like Eleuthera or Long ⁢island, where prices can be more reasonable compared to Nassau.

Dining can also be budget-friendly⁣ if you venture away from high-end⁢ restaurants. Local eateries ⁤known⁣ as ‘fish fries’ offer authentic Bahamian cuisine ⁤at‍ a⁤ fraction ⁤of⁣ the cost. Examples⁤ include the famous “Arawak‍ Cay” in Nassau, where you can savor local dishes for much less than resort ⁣dining establishments. Additionally, consider ‘self-catering’ ⁣options‌ where you can buy groceries ⁣and cook your own meals, as many accommodations provide kitchen ⁢facilities.

What practical considerations should I keep in mind ⁢when traveling to the Bahamas?

When traveling to the Bahamas,practical considerations ‌can make your trip ⁢smoother and‌ more enjoyable. First, consider the travel season—peak tourist ⁤season runs from mid-December to mid-April,⁣ during which prices ⁤for flights and accommodations can increase significantly. If you have versatility, traveling during the ‍shoulder ​months⁤ of ​May or November can yield lower prices.

Don’t forget to check for any entry requirements, such as visa regulations‍ or health advisories. Depending on your nationality,you may need⁣ to present a valid passport or certain vaccinations. Budget travelers should be aware that some islands may ⁢have limited ATMs, so carrying a mix of cash and cards is wise. ⁣Lastly, be mindful of local customs and codes of conduct ⁤to‍ ensure respectful​ interactions, ‌which can enhance your overall experience.
